The Efficiency Paradox

On the surface, hydro excavation seems slower than traditional mechanical methods. A skilled trackhoe operator can move large volumes of soil quickly. So why would you choose a method that appears more time-intensive?

The answer lies in understanding what actually keeps projects on schedule. It's not how fast you dig—it's how few problems you create while digging. A trackhoe can excavate quickly right up until the moment it severs a utility line. Then your "efficient" excavation method shuts down your entire project for days or weeks while repairs are made and investigations conclude.

True Efficiency Includes What Doesn't Happen

Hydro excavation prevents the catastrophic delays that come from utility strikes. But the efficiency benefits extend well beyond avoided disasters. Consider the typical workflow for traditional excavation around known utilities. Utilities are located and marked. Excavation proceeds slowly with frequent stops to check depth and proximity. Hand digging begins several feet away from marked locations. The process is necessarily cautious and time-consuming.

With hydro excavation, you can work continuously with confidence. The soft dig process doesn't require the constant stop-start of mechanical excavation near utilities. You're not switching between mechanical excavation, hand digging, and verification. The work flows steadily from start to completion.

Working in Constrained Spaces

Mid-Atlantic urban projects often involve working in spaces where traditional excavation equipment struggles. Narrow alleyways in Baltimore rowhome neighborhoods. Tight utility corridors in DC federal properties. Congested job sites in Philadelphia where multiple trades are working simultaneously.

Hydro excavation equipment, especially modern truck-mounted units, can access difficult locations and work in confined spaces where positioning a trackhoe is impossible or impractical. The excavation hose extends hundreds of feet from the truck, meaning the equipment can remain on the street while work happens in tight quarters.

Weather and Seasonal Advantages

The Mid-Atlantic region experiences real winters. Frozen ground stops many excavation projects cold. Hydro excavation systems using heated water can work effectively in conditions that would shut down mechanical excavation. This extends your working season and keeps projects moving during winter months.

Wet conditions that turn traditional excavation sites into mud pits have less impact on hydro excavation. The vacuum system removes water along with soil, keeping the work area manageable even in challenging drainage situations.

Cleaner Sites, Faster Follow-On Work

Efficiency isn't just about the excavation phase—it's about enabling the trades that follow. Hydro excavation creates clean, precise excavations that make subsequent work easier. Utility installers, concrete crews, and inspection teams can work more efficiently when utilities are clearly exposed and the work area is clean.

The removed material is contained in the hydro excavation truck's debris tank rather than piled around the excavation. This means less site cleanup, easier material disposal, and better access for other trades working in the area.

The Real Schedule Impact

Calculate your typical project schedule and identify where delays actually occur. It's rarely the excavation itself—it's the contingency time added for potential utility conflicts, the delays when strikes happen, the weather days when conditions make work impossible, and the extended timelines for working around congested utilities.

Hydro excavation addresses all of these delay sources. It reduces contingency requirements because risk is minimized. It prevents the catastrophic delays of utility strikes. It works in weather and soil conditions that stop traditional methods. It handles complex utility environments without extended hand-digging requirements.
